Denmark’s Magnus Cort Nielsen won the tenth stage of the Tour de France and ended in a split in Megève ahead of New Zealand’s Nicholas Schulz and Spain’s Luis León Sánchez.

In an exciting final judged at the second category port at the airport of the Alpine city, Sánchez was on the verge of adding his fifth victory in the Tour and breaking an 80-stage drought in a row without a Spanish victory in the French tour.

Bahrain’s Murcian lacked his strength in the final section after starting an attack with 4km left and was overtaken by Schulz in the final sprint and overtaken by Nielsen, one of the most active. In this issue, wearing the King of the Mountain jersey in the early days.
